Technical Breakdown: Choosing the Right Technology

Selecting the correct industrial dehumidifier depends heavily on the ambient temperature and the required humidity levels of your specific application.

Refrigerant (Compressor) Dehumidifiers

These are the most common types of commercial dehumidifier units. They work by cooling air below its dew point, causing moisture to condense into a tank or drain.

  • Best for: High-temperature environments with high humidity (e.g., Luanda coastal areas).
  • Efficiency: Very high in warm conditions.
  • Common Use: General warehouse dehumidifier applications and gyms.

Desiccant Dehumidifiers

Instead of cooling the air, a desiccant dehumidifier uses a moisture-absorbing wheel (silica gel).

  • Best for: Low-temperature environments or where extremely low humidity (below 35%) is required.
  • Efficiency: Consistent across all temperature ranges.
  • Common Use: Cold room dehumidifier applications, pharmaceutical labs, and dry storage for sensitive electronics.

Aquatic Excellence: Swimming Pool Dehumidification Science

Indoor swimming pools represent the ultimate humidity challenge: constant evaporation creates moisture loads that would overwhelm any standard HVAC system. A typical 10-meter residential pool evaporates 50-70 liters of water daily, releasing that moisture directly into the surrounding air. Without proper control, this creates condensation on windows, corrosion of metal fixtures, chlorine odor buildup, and structural damage to ceiling materials.

Indoor pool dehumidifier supplier in Doha Qatar.

 

The swimming pool dehumidifier is a specialized piece of engineering, far more sophisticated than general-purpose units. These systems typically combine three functions: dehumidification, heating, and ventilation. The process works through these stages:

  1. Moisture Extraction: Humid air passes over refrigerated coils, condensing water vapor which drains away
  2. Heat Recovery: The latent heat of condensation is captured and redirected to heat pool water or space air
  3. Air Circulation: Treated air returns to the pool area, creating a barrier of dry air over the water surface to reduce evaporation

For a luxury villa in Doha with an indoor pool, a properly sized swimming pool dehumidifier maintains 50-60% relative humidity and eliminates chlorine smell: creating a resort-quality environment. These units handle 100-200 liters of moisture daily, with stainless steel construction to resist corrosive chlorine exposure.

The energy efficiency of modern pool dehumidifiers is remarkable. By recovering heat that would otherwise be wasted, these systems can reduce pool heating costs by 60% compared to traditional gas heaters. In Qatar’s climate, where outdoor pools are unusable during summer due to excessive evaporation, indoor pools with proper dehumidification offer year-round aquatic enjoyment.

Installation requires professional engineering: calculating pool surface area, water temperature, air temperature differential, and occupancy patterns. Undersized systems run continuously without achieving target humidity, while oversized units cycle too frequently, reducing efficiency and component life. This is where selecting an experienced Dehumidifier Supplier in Qatar becomes critical.

Industrial Versatility: Matching Technology to Application

Not all dehumidifiers are created equal, and choosing the wrong technology for your application wastes money and fails to solve the problem. Understanding when to deploy desiccant versus compressor systems is fundamental to successful moisture control.

Compressor (Refrigerant) Technology works like your home refrigerator: humid air passes over cold coils, condensing moisture which drips into a collection tank. These units excel in warm environments (above 15°C) with moderate to high humidity. They’re energy-efficient, relatively affordable, and available in capacities from small portable units (30 liters daily) to large commercial dehumidifier systems (300+ liters daily).

Best applications for compressor units include:

  • Standard warehouses and factories
  • Retail spaces and offices
  • Residential installations
  • Indoor pools and gyms
  • Any space maintained above 15°C

Desiccant Technology uses a different approach: humid air passes through a rotating wheel coated with moisture-absorbing silica gel. A heating element regenerates the wheel continuously, driving absorbed moisture to exhaust. Desiccant systems work brilliantly in cold environments where compressor units fail.

Best applications for desiccant units include:

  • Cold room dehumidifier applications below 10°C
  • Pharmaceutical storage requiring ultra-low humidity (<30% RH)
  • Ice rinks and frozen food facilities
  • Winter construction sites
  • Chemical storage requiring absolute dryness

For Qatar’s industrial sector, CtrlTech’s industrial dehumidifier range includes both technologies. A food processing plant might use compressor units for general production areas (20-25°C) while deploying desiccant systems specifically for cold storage zones (-5°C to +5°C). This hybrid approach optimizes both performance and operating cost.

The Ultimate Dehumidifier Sizing Guide: Mastering Capacity Calculations for Every Application

Getting the right dehumidifier size isn’t something you want to guess at. A unit that’s too small will run 24/7 and still leave you with damp walls, while an oversized system wastes thousands in upfront costs and energy bills. The difference between “close enough” and precision? That’s where moisture problems: or massive savings: live.

The good news? You don’t need to crack out a slide rule. Our dehumidifier capacity calculation tool does the heavy lifting for you, whether you’re dealing with a musty basement or a 50,000 sq ft warehouse. But understanding what goes into dehumidifier sizing calculation helps you make smarter decisions and avoid costly mistakes. Let’s break down exactly how to calculate dehumidifier size for any space you manage.

Why Dehumidifier Sizing Actually Matters

Think about it: you wouldn’t install a residential air conditioner in a manufacturing plant, right? The same logic applies to humidity control. A dehumidifier capacity selection mistake doesn’t just mean discomfort: it means real damage.

Under-sizing consequences:

  • Equipment runs continuously without reaching target humidity
  • Mold growth continues unchecked in corners and hidden spaces
  • Products get damaged (rust on metal parts, warping in wood, clumping in powders)
  • Higher energy bills from a unit that never cycles off
  • Premature equipment failure from constant operation

Over-sizing problems:

  • Wasted capital investment (industrial units aren’t cheap)
  • Short cycling that prevents proper moisture extraction
  • Uneven humidity control across the space
  • Higher maintenance costs and component wear
  • Unnecessarily high energy consumption

The sweet spot? That’s what proper dehumidifier sizing guide methodology gets you. Let’s walk through the right approach for different applications.

Starting Simple: Residential Dehumidifier Calculation

For homes and small basements, the dehumidifier calculation process is straightforward. You’re looking at square footage combined with current humidity conditions.

The basic formula:
Multiply your room length by width to get square footage. Then check your current relative humidity with a hygrometer. Match these two factors against capacity requirements.

For a moderately damp 600 sq ft basement (60-70% RH), you’d typically need a 30-pint capacity unit. If that same space is extremely wet with visible water stains (80-90% RH), bump it up to 40-45 pints.

Quick residential sizing reference:

  • 500 sq ft at moderate dampness: 25-30 pints
  • 1,000 sq ft at high humidity: 50-60 pints
  • 1,500 sq ft very damp basement: 70-80 pints
  • 2,000 sq ft with multiple moisture sources: 90-110 pints

But here’s where people mess up: they forget to account for moisture sources. That 600 sq ft basement might need 30 pints based on size alone, but if you’re doing laundry down there and have a bathroom? Add another 15-20 pints to your requirement. Each shower adds roughly 0.5 pints of moisture per use. A laundry room contributes 4 pints. These add up fast.

Humidity load calculation for dehumidifier.

The Deep Dive: Swimming Pool Dehumidifier Calculation

Indoor pools are humidity nightmares if you don’t get the sizing right. The swimming pool dehumidifier calculation is probably the most complex application you’ll encounter because evaporation rates vary dramatically based on multiple factors.

Key variables affecting pool humidity:

  • Water surface area (in square feet)
  • Water temperature
  • Air temperature
  • Air movement across water surface
  • Pool activity level (calm vs. diving/splashing)
  • Whether the pool is covered when not in use

The standard dehumidifier calculation formula for pools uses evaporation rate:

Evaporation Rate = Surface Area × Activity Factor × (Saturation Pressure at Water Temp – Partial Vapor Pressure in Air)

Don’t worry: you don’t need to memorize that. What you need to know is that a typical residential indoor pool (400 sq ft surface) at 82°F water temperature can evaporate 50-80 gallons per day in active use. That’s roughly 400-640 pints of moisture generation daily.

For indoor swimming pool dehumidifier applications, professional sizing typically requires:

  • 600-800 sq ft pool: 150-200 pints daily capacity
  • 1,000-1,500 sq ft pool: 250-350 pints daily capacity
  • Commercial aquatic centers: 500+ pints daily capacity

The mistake people make? They size for calm water conditions. But pools get used. Activity increases evaporation by 30-50%. Always size for active use conditions, or you’ll end up with condensation dripping from ceilings and corroding HVAC systems.

The Science Behind the Numbers: Dehumidifier Calculation Formula Explained

Let’s get technical for a minute. Understanding the actual dehumidifier calculation formula helps you validate sizing recommendations and catch errors.

The moisture load formula:
Total Moisture Load (pints/day) = Baseline Load + Source Loads + Infiltration Load

Breaking it down:

  1. Baseline Load = Square Footage × Moisture Factor
    • Moderate conditions: 0.02
    • Very damp conditions: 0.03
    • Extremely wet conditions: 0.04
  2. Source Loads:
    • Occupants: Number of people × 0.5 pints per person per 8 hours
    • Bathrooms: Number × 3 pints each
    • Kitchens: 6 pints per kitchen
    • Laundry: 4 pints per laundry area
    • Pools: Calculate separately using evaporation rate
  3. Infiltration Load:
    • Air changes from ventilation × volume × humidity difference factor

Capacity terminology you need to know:

  • PPD (Pints Per Day): Standard measurement at 80°F and 60% RH
  • LPD (Liters Per Day): Metric equivalent (1 pint = 0.473 liters)
  • CFM (Cubic Feet per Minute): Airflow through the unit

Here’s a real-world example combining everything:

2,500 sq ft industrial facility with:

  • Very damp conditions (0.03 factor)
  • 10 employees working 8-hour shifts
  • 1 bathroom
  • Loading dock door opened 20 times daily

Calculation:

  • Baseline: 2,500 × 0.03 = 75 pints
  • Occupants: 10 × 0.5 = 5 pints
  • Bathroom: 3 pints
  • Infiltration from dock: +20% = 17 pints
  • Total: 100 pints per day minimum

Factor in safety margin (add 15-20% for equipment longevity and peak conditions), and you’re looking at a 120-130 pint daily capacity requirement. That points you toward either a single 150L industrial dehumidification system or dual smaller units.

Choosing Your Technology: Desiccant vs. Compressor

Understanding the difference between desiccant and compressor dehumidifiers is essential for making the right investment.

Compressor (Refrigerant) Dehumidifiers work like your air conditioner. They pull humid air over cold coils, condensing the moisture into water that drains away. These units perform best in temperatures above 15°C and humidity levels above 45% RH. They’re energy-efficient for standard Doha conditions and ideal for warehouses, commercial spaces, and residential applications. Capacity typically ranges from 50–200 liters per day for commercial models.

Desiccant (Rotor) Dehumidifiers use a rotating wheel coated with moisture-absorbing material: usually silica gel or zeolite. As humid air passes through one side of the rotor, the desiccant absorbs the moisture. The rotor then turns through a heated regeneration zone, releasing the captured moisture as exhaust. Desiccant units excel in cold environments (below 15°C) and ultra-dry applications (below 35% RH). They’re the only viable option for pharmaceutical cold rooms, subzero storage, and electronics manufacturing.

The trade-off? Desiccant units consume more energy due to the regeneration heating cycle, but they deliver moisture removal in conditions where compressor units simply fail.

For most Qatar applications: warehouses, offices, hotels, and homes: compressor technology offers the best balance of performance and efficiency. Reserve desiccant systems for specialized low-temperature or ultra-dry requirements.

7 Mistakes You're Making with Warehouse Humidity Control (and How to Fix Them)

Warehouse humidity control is not optional in the UAE and GCC region. With outdoor humidity levels regularly exceeding 80-90% during summer months, your inventory faces constant risk. Rust on metal goods. Mold on textiles. Clumping in powders. Warping in wood products. Degraded packaging.

The frustrating part? Most warehouse humidity problems stem from preventable mistakes: not equipment failures.

Whether you manage a logistics facility in Dubai, a distribution center in Saudi Arabia, or a storage warehouse in Qatar, these seven errors cost businesses thousands of dirhams in damaged stock every year. Here’s how to identify them and fix them fast.


Mistake #1: Sealing Walls While Ignoring Door Openings

Many facility managers invest heavily in vapor barriers, wall insulation, and structural sealing. The logic seems sound: stop moisture from entering through the building envelope.

The reality? Door openings account for 60-80% of moisture load in active warehouses. Vapor permeation through walls, floors, and roofs contributes less than 5%.

We’ve seen companies in the GCC spend significant budgets on sealing projects that reduce moisture load by only 6%. Meanwhile, installing high-speed doors or implementing loading dock controls can cut moisture infiltration by 40-50% at a fraction of the cost.

The fix: Prioritize door management first. Install rapid-roll doors at loading bays. Create air curtains at frequently used entrances. Establish operational procedures that minimize door opening time. Address structural sealing only after you’ve controlled the primary moisture entry points.

CtrlTech warehouse dehumidification system.

Mistake #2: Sizing Dehumidifiers for Average Conditions

This mistake appears in warehouse after warehouse across Dubai, Abu Dhabi, and the wider Middle East. Facility planners calculate dehumidification requirements using average annual humidity data. The system works fine for eight months: then fails catastrophically during peak summer.

In coastal areas of the UAE, relative humidity can spike above 95% on summer mornings. A system sized for 70% average RH simply cannot handle these peak loads.

The fix: Size your industrial dehumidifier for worst-case scenarios. Account for:

  • Peak seasonal humidity (August-September in the Gulf)
  • Morning condensation periods
  • Moisture released by incoming goods
  • Door opening frequency during busy shipping periods

Our dehumidifier capacity calculation guide walks through the proper methodology. A properly sized commercial warehouse dehumidifier handles peak loads with capacity to spare: protecting your inventory year-round.


Mistake #3: Targeting Relative Humidity Without Considering Surface Temperature

Specifications often state: “Maintain 50% RH in the warehouse.” The dehumidification system hits that target. Yet condensation still forms on the metal roof, on cold storage containers, or on goods near exterior walls.

What went wrong?

Condensation doesn’t depend on relative humidity alone. It occurs when surface temperatures drop below the dew point. A warehouse maintaining 50% RH at 30°C has a dew point around 18°C. If your metal roof drops to 15°C overnight due to radiant cooling, condensation forms: regardless of your RH reading.

The fix: Define your humidity control goals around preventing condensation on surfaces, not achieving a nominal RH percentage. Calculate the dew point required to prevent condensation at your lowest expected surface temperatures. This approach requires more sophisticated monitoring but delivers actual protection for your inventory.

Duct Warehouse dehumidifier by CtrlTech Dubai.


Mistake #4: Neglecting Initial Drying Loads

New warehouses present a hidden challenge. Concrete floors, freshly painted walls, and construction materials release moisture for weeks: sometimes months: after completion. The same applies to large shipments of newly manufactured goods that contain residual production moisture.

Facilities that don’t account for these initial drying loads experience humidity spikes that overwhelm their dehumidification systems during the most critical early period.

The fix: Design your warehouse dehumidification system with capacity for initial drying periods. Alternatively, deploy temporary additional dehumidification when:

  • Opening a new facility
  • Receiving large shipments of fresh inventory
  • Storing goods immediately after manufacturing processes

Portable industrial warehouse dehumidifiers work well for supplementing fixed systems during these peak-load periods.


Mistake #5: Poor Air Distribution in Large Spaces

Installing a powerful dehumidifier means nothing if treated air doesn’t reach all areas of your warehouse. We regularly assess facilities where one section maintains perfect humidity while goods in distant corners suffer moisture damage.

Large warehouses in the GCC often exceed 5,000-10,000 square meters. Without proper air distribution, you create humidity gradients: dry zones near the dehumidifier and damp zones far away.

The fix: Ducted dehumidification systems solve this problem completely. Central units with properly designed ductwork distribute dry air evenly throughout the facility. Strategic placement of supply and return air points ensures consistent humidity levels from floor to ceiling, corner to corner.

For existing warehouses, conduct an air circulation assessment before installing new equipment. The most powerful warehouse dehumidifier delivers poor results without adequate distribution infrastructure.

Industrial-Dehumidifier For Warehouse moisture control.


Mistake #6: Ignoring Product-Specific Humidity Requirements

Not all inventory requires the same humidity level. Electronics need relative humidity below 40% to prevent corrosion and electrostatic discharge. Pharmaceuticals have strict stability requirements tied to regulatory compliance. Food products must balance moisture control with packaging integrity.

Applying a single moisture control approach across diverse inventory categories leads to either over-drying some products or under-protecting others.

The fix: Assess each product category’s unique moisture requirements:

Product Type Recommended RH Range Primary Concern
Electronics 30-40% Corrosion, ESD
Pharmaceuticals 45-55% Stability, compliance
Textiles 50-55% Mold, fiber integrity
Metal goods 40-50% Rust, oxidation
Paper/Packaging 45-55% Warping, degradation

Configure zone-based humidity control where different warehouse sections maintain different target levels. This approach optimizes protection while reducing energy costs in less sensitive areas.


Mistake #7: Reactive Rather Than Proactive Monitoring

Too many warehouses discover humidity problems only after damage occurs. A musty smell. Visible condensation. Customer complaints about corroded goods. By then, losses have already accumulated.

Humidity damage is cumulative and often invisible in early stages. Metal corrosion begins at the microscopic level. Mold spores establish before visible growth appears. Packaging weakens gradually before failing.

The fix: Implement continuous humidity monitoring with alert thresholds. Modern warehouse dehumidifier systems integrate with building management systems (BMS) to provide:

  • Real-time humidity and temperature data
  • Trend analysis identifying gradual changes
  • Automatic alerts when levels exceed targets
  • Performance logging for compliance documentation

Position sensors strategically: near doors, in corners, at different heights, and near temperature-sensitive surfaces. Don’t rely on a single reading to represent your entire facility.
